3. Assigning Keywords

You need to be careful when assigning keywords to your web pages. You can use an SEO keyword research tool for this too.

When you identify the keywords you wish to target, assign them one web page only. If you assign the same keyword to multiple web pages, then it may lead to keyword cannibalization and your ability to rank well will decrease.

5. The URL Should Contain Keywords

Don’t overlook the structure of the URL. A good practice is to ensure that the URL contains keywords that provide users and Google an idea of what the destination web page is talking about.

Google elaborated that the URL’s structure should be simple. It should contain readable phrases instead of lengthy ID numbers.

According to the Alexa blog, short URLs with fewer than 128 characters perform better in search engine result pages. Adding keywords in your URL can boost your site’s visibility.

6. SEO Keyword Research for Compelling Titles & Descriptions

The titles, description, and content must be compelling and unique. Duplicate content can save your time, but it can mess up your reputation and damage your credibility as a brand.

Best SEO Tips to FollowBest practices to follow while writing your title tag:

  • Start from your target keyword.
  • The title must match with the search intent.
  • Avoid creating duplicate title tags.
  • Don’t do keyword stuffing.
  • Your title tag must be concise.

Best practices to follow while writing your meta descriptions

  • It should provide a short summary of the topic.
  • Meta descriptions should be unique for each page.
  • Must include keywords.
  • The content must match the search intent.

8. Remove Links From Poor Websites

Backlinks from low-quality spammy sites can negatively affect your SEO. Use a good and reliable tool to review the list of web page linked to your site.

Google offers some free tools that you can use to remove these low-quality links.

11. Add Your Keyword in the Image Alt Tag

Images that you include in your content also play a part in improving SEO.

Make sure the image is related to your topic. Also, include the keyword in the image alt tag.

Search crawlers will see this information even if the image doesn’t load.
